Job description

The ideal candidate will have extensive experience supporting large-scale, customer-facing websites, digital experience platforms, and enterprise content management systems. This individual will serve as the primary liaison between business, marketing, UX, analytics, and technology teams, ensuring business objectives are translated into actionable requirements and successfully delivered through Agile practices., Business Analyst Responsibilities

  • Collaborate with Digital Product Owner and stakeholders to gather, analyze, and document business and technical requirements for customer-facing web initiatives.
  • Translate business needs into detailed user stories, acceptance criteria, process flows, and functional requirements.
  • Manage and maintain the Azure DevOps (ADO) backlog, ensuring alignment with business priorities and customer experience objectives.
  • Lead business-side User Acceptance Testing (UAT), including test planning, execution oversight, defect tracking, and stakeholder signoff.
  • Prepare milestone updates and sprint summaries for business and technical stakeholders.
  • Coordinate with business users for testing, feedback loops, and change management to ensure smooth rollout of features.

Scrum Master Responsibilities

  • Facilitate core Agile ceremonies, including sprint planning, daily stand-ups, sprint reviews, and retrospectives.
  • Act as a servant leader to the team-identifying and removing blockers to maintain delivery momentum.
  • Monitor sprint health, team velocity, and workflow; proactively identify areas for improvement.
  • Champion Agile best practices and foster a high-performing, collaborative team environment.
  • Support the Digital Product Owner in sprint goal definition and stakeholder alignment.
  • Champion Agile best practices and promote a culture of accountability, transparency, and continuous delivery.
